English electronic group Crazy P, formed in Nottingham, blend disco, soul, and house. Known for dynamic live shows, hits include "The Way We Swing" and "Get It On." Fronted by Danielle Moore since 2002, they gained acclaim with albums like "When We On" and "Age of the Ego." They've toured globally, supporting acts like Chic and Chaka Khan, and have a strong fan base in Australia. Originally named Crazy Penis, they changed to Crazy P in 2008. The band includes members Chris Todd, Jim Baron, Tim Davis, and Matt Klose.
Róisín Murphy, born in Arklow, is a trailblazer in electronic pop, famed for Moloko’s “Sing It Back” and solo albums like “Róisín Machine.” Known for her vivid stage presence, she merges disco, soul, house, and techno.
